Q21: How can I estimate how often a system will run to re-freeze the
eutectic solution in my cabinet?
A:
The easiest way is to use a container similar in size to the
eutectic tank you intend using, (our 32-26 tank = 4Lt, 45-30 tank
= 8Lt, 50-40 tank = 5Lt). Fill the container with water and place
in your deep freezer for at least 4 or 5 days. Then put this
frozen container high up inside your empty boat cabinet and see
how long it lasts before totally thawing. This will give a guide
as to how long each freeze / thaw cycle of a eutectic system will
be. For example, if the test lasted 48 hours then your system will
run for one freeze cycle every second day . Each re-freeze cycle
will be approx 2.3 hours (small tank) to 4.7 hours long (large
tank) and consume a total of approximately 11 to 23 amperes.

Q26: Why are eutectic refrigeration systems so efficient on power?
A:
Refrigeration systems are more efficient when heat rapidly
saturates the evaporator, and as the eutectic evaporator is in a
liquid it can rapidly absorb heat and lower temperatures. By
comparison aluminum plate evaporators cooling the air run at much
less efficient temperatures where the refrigeration systems
coefficient factor is very low. (Put a hot can of drink in ice
water and another on the shelf of a fridge at the same
temperature. You will be drinking the one from the ice water ten
times sooner!) So not only is the system operating in much more
efficient conditions, it does the job so much quicker and with the
eutectic hold-over, runs much less often. An aluminum evaporator
plate system will typically cycle say 10 minutes on 20 minutes
off. (Two cycles per hour or 48 cycles per day while the Eutectic
system runs once per day or twice in hot conditions.)

Q28: How do I work out the capacity of my cabinet in liters?
A:
To establish a cabinets capacity multiply the width x depth x
height in centimeters, then move the decimal point three digits
left to give the result in liters.
Q29: How important is my cabinets' insulation?
A:
The thickness and quality of the cabinets insulation is most
important. A refrigeration system removes heat from the insulated
cabinet causing the cabinet and stored product's temperature to be
lowered until the required temperature is reached and the
refrigeration unit is switched off. Now how long the
refrigeration remains off for is determined by how effective the
insulation is at resisting heat trying to penetrate into the
colder interior. The thickness, quality and seal of the insulation
are the important factors.
Q30: Why do you recommend thicker insulation in the base of the
cabinet?
A:
Heat penetrates the cabinet in a rising manner. Therefore the shortest way for
it to penetrate a cabinet is upward through the base, secondly on
an upwards angle through the walls and least likely through the
top. We recommend at least 100mm of high density urethane for the
base, 75mm for the walls, while 50mm is adequate for the top. Add
50% for freezer cabinets.
Q31: What insulation material could I use for my new built-in galley
cabinet?
A:
Generally refrigeration grade high density urethane slab or two
mix high density urethane poured insitu is quite satisfactory
specially if thickness is as much as practical and the insulation
is installed with NO voids and is properly sealed. Fibre glass
over urethane panel provides an excellent cabinet. Cabinet
interiors are best made from non heat conductive materials such as
fibre glass or plastics.
Q32: What are common problems with older cabinets?
A:
A common cause of heat gain into a cabinet is delaminating. This
is where the insulation has become detached from the cabinets
inner or outer liner. Air can fill the vacant area depositing
water where the insulation should be rendering the insulation
useless. To check, first empty the cabinet then tap the insides to
locate any looseness. Check the outer cabinet for sweating or
water dripping stains. If there is a problem then it may be easier
to rectify before fitting refrigeration.
Q33: How do I check my lid or door seal for air leakage?
A:
Place a torch inside on a dark night and check for any light
escape areas. Remember, every bit of heat that enters the cabinet
has to be extracted by the refrigeration system!
Q34: My cabinet is difficult to clean. Are there any tips?
A:
After cleaning, thoroughly dry and warm the interior if possible.
Use some old style floor wax to coat the cabinets entire interior.
Remove excess wax then operate cabinet. This will make the next
cleanout much easier, reduce the possibility of odour build-up and
restrict any moisture from entering insulation through any defect
in the interior seal.
